2 Unterschiedliche Buttons auf eine Höhe

Brian Folte

Angesehenes Mitglied
Hallo ich schon wieder und zwar kämpfe ich seit 2 tagen mit meinem neuen Menü und komme jetzt einfach nicht mehr weiter.
Ich möchte das meine Buttons zwischen Tabellen Boden und Button Boden kein Raum mehr frei ist.
Das ist mir nun auch mit dem einen Menü geglückt. Hier mal der Code:

HTML:
CODE <td width="40%" class="r">
<p style="margin-left:20pt"><a class="menu1" href="index.php"><center>AGB</center></a></p>
<p style="margin-left:110pt"><a class="menu1" href="index.php"><center>Hilfe</center></a></p>
<p style="margin-left:200pt"><a class="menu1" href="index.php"><center>AGB</center></a></p>
<p style="margin-left:290pt"><a class="menu1" href="index.php"><center>Hilfe</center></a></p>
<p style="margin-left:380pt"><a class="menu1" href="index.php"><center>Hilfe</center></a></p>
</td>



CSS:

CODE .r { font-family: Arial, Helvetica, sans-serif;
font-size: 14px;
font-weight: bolder;
color: Red;

padding-top: 0px;
padding-bottom: 0px;
text-indent: 5pt;
vertical-align: baseline;

background-repeat : repeat; letter-spacing : 1px;
}


Soweit klappt alles wunderbar. Nun kommt das Problem:


CODE <td width="60%" class="e">
<p style="margin-left:20pt"><a class="kmenu" href="index.php"><center>Hilfe</center></a></p>
<p style="margin-left:100"><a class="kmenu" href="index.php"><center>Hilfe</center></a></p>
</td>


Class e ist genauso wie e. Aber ich bekomme die kleineren Buttons einfach nicht auf den Boden.

So sieht der CSS Code aus der mir meine Buttons definiert:

CODE .kmenu
{
background:url(../graphics/kmenu.gif);
padding:5px;
font-size: 110px;
display: block;
width:60px; (bei den ersten Menü steht hier 110px)
height: 15px; (bei dem ersten Menü steht hier 25px)
text-decoration:none;
float: left;
}


.kmenu:active
{
background:url(../graphics/kmenu.gif);
}
a.home span {
display: none;
}
.clearer {
clear: both;
line-height: 1px;
height: 1px;


}


Wenn ich beide Buttons auf 25px Höhe setzte klappt alles wunderbar aber nicht wenn ich den zweiten Button auf 15px setzte.

LG Brian
 
Sei ein Macho und zeigt dem Teil wo es lang geht. Erzwing die Position der Buttons einfach:
Hier wird der in halt einer Zelle(<td>) auf die Posotion 9 Pixel vom inneren Fensterand: und 9 pivxel vom linken inneren Fensterand erzwungen. Wenn es nur die Höhe sein soll, lässt du das Left-Attribut einfach weg

CSS:
.menu {position: absolute;left: 9px;top: 9px;}

Html:
<Table><TR><TD class="menu"><img src =".....


Gruß Ronny
 
Hallo danke für deine schnelle Antwort. Wenn ich das nun so einbinde, dann rutsch mein Menü aus der eigendlich Tabelle raus bis ganz nach oben zum Seitenanfang.

LG Brian
 
Ist doch auch logisch. Du musst die Werte 9 px für dein Menü anpassen.

Woher soll ich auch wissen wo die Teile platziert werden sollen.
wink.gif


Gruß Ronny
 
Zurück
Oben